Transaction d21e3874185ee0b5eb5fca13917226872995fa58e97a63561ef9aab178e18994
1 Input
1 Output
-
d21e3874185ee0b5eb5fca13917226872995fa58e97a63561ef9aab178e18994:0
- value
- 954576
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c7693c17a2dcaec7a06e5157fad9deec81749b2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q1uLECTKNmLvRSKyibFGfP1D1fgm5eeEH